Fond Blanc Chicken Stock in a pressure cooker recipeFond Blanc - or Fond Blanc Ordinaire - is French for ordinary white stock - so this version is a white chicken stock that you would use in places where a darker 'Fond Brun' or roasted chicken stock would have a flavour that's too overpowering.
